1. Choose Dark and Bold Color Palettes
Masculine interiors are often defined by darker hues and bold colors. A leather sofa, especially in shades like dark brown, black, or tan, fits perfectly with moody color schemes such as charcoal, navy, or forest green. These tones add depth and character, giving the room a grounded, powerful feel.

Recommended Color Combinations
- Black and Charcoal Grey
- Deep Navy with Tan Accents
- Forest Green and Dark Brown Leather
2. Industrial Style Accents
Leather sofas naturally pair well with industrial elements like exposed brick walls, metal light fixtures, and raw wood furniture. The mix of textures—leather, metal, and wood—creates a dynamic, masculine vibe that is both modern and timeless.
Key Industrial Elements
- Metal Bed Frames
- Exposed Lighting Fixtures
- Concrete or Wood Flooring

3. Layer Textures for Depth
Incorporating different textures is essential to avoid making the bedroom look flat. Leather sofas add a soft yet rugged texture to the room. Complement this by adding materials like wool, faux fur, or velvet to your bedding and throw pillows, enhancing the warmth and comfort of the space.
Textile Suggestions
- Wool Blankets
- Velvet Cushions
- Faux Fur Throws

4. Incorporate Strong, Masculine Furniture Pieces
Furniture with clean lines, minimalistic designs, and masculine materials like dark woods and metals can further enhance the overall look of the room. A solid wood bedframe or a metal nightstand will complement a leather sofa beautifully, adding to the room’s bold aesthetic.
Furniture Ideas
- Wooden Platform Bed
- Metal Nightstands
- Steel Bookshelves
5. Use Vintage and Leather Accents
To maintain consistency, consider incorporating more leather elements through accents like leather ottomans, headboards, or vintage leather suitcases as décor. These add subtle hints of the leather theme while making the room feel cohesive and rich in style.
Accent Suggestions
- Leather-bound Books
- Vintage Suitcases
- Leather Ottomans

6. Bold Wall Art
Artwork is a great way to inject personality into a masculine bedroom. Choose bold, abstract pieces or black-and-white photography that can enhance the strength of the room. Large-scale artwork above the bed or behind the sofa works particularly well.
Types of Art
- Abstract Paintings
- Black-and-White Photography
- Metal Wall Sculptures

8. Integrate Natural Elements
Natural materials like wood, stone, and leather often work well in masculine designs. Pair the leather sofa with wooden bedside tables, stone planters, or a live-edge wooden bench at the foot of the bed. These elements bring warmth and a grounded feel to the bedroom.
Suggestions for Natural Elements
- Live-edge Wood Benches
- Stone or Concrete Planters
- Wooden Nightstands
9. Ambient Lighting
Lighting plays a crucial role in setting the mood in a masculine bedroom. Opt for warm, ambient lighting that enhances the rich tones of the leather sofa. Industrial-style fixtures or minimalist lamps with dimmable features can add sophistication and comfort to the space.
Recommended Lighting Types
- Edison Bulb Pendant Lights
- Industrial Floor Lamps
- Wall Sconces with Adjustable Brightness

10. Layered Rugs
A leather sofa can sometimes feel cold on its own, so layering a rug underfoot adds warmth and comfort. Go for thick, textured rugs like wool or jute to enhance the masculine atmosphere while making the space cozier.
Top Rug Choices
- Wool Rugs
- Jute Rugs
- Leather and Hide Rugs
